This Arrowhead Mounting Engine RH is designed for the right-hand side engine support in selected Audi and Volkswagen models. As part of the ENGINE MOUNTING MOUNTINGS category, it helps secure the engine in place while dampening vibrations and reducing noise during operation. The mount features a robust cast metal body with integrated rubber bushings to absorb engine movement and maintain alignment under various driving conditions.

Common symptoms of a failing engine mount include excessive engine vibration, clunking noises during acceleration or braking, engine movement when shifting gears, visible sagging or separation of the mount, and increased cabin noise. If you notice any of these issues, your engine mounting may need inspection or replacement.
Replacing a worn or damaged engine mount is important to maintain proper engine alignment and to prevent further strain on drivetrain components. It is advisable to replace the mount if you experience increased vibrations, noises, or if the rubber bushing shows signs of cracking or separation.

Vehicle Compatibility
This part is confirmed to fit the following vehicles:
AUDI A3 / S3 (8V1, 8VK) 2012 – 2018 2.0 TDI (CRFC) – 105 kW / 143 HP
AUDI A3 / S3 Saloon (8VS, 8VM) 2013 – 2021 2.0 TDI (CRBC|CRLB|CRUA|DBGA|DCYA|DEJA|DFGA) – 110 kW / 150 HP
AUDI A3 / S3 Saloon (8VS, 8VM) 2013 – 2021 2.0 TDI (CRFC) – 105 kW / 143 HP
AUDI A3 / S3 Sportback (8VA, 8VF) 2013 – 2021 2.0 TDI (CRBC|CRLB|CRUA|DBGA|DCYA|DEJA|DFGA) – 110 kW / 150 HP
AUDI A3 / S3 Sportback (8VA, 8VF) 2013 – 2021 2.0 TDI (CRFC) – 105 kW / 143 HP
AUDI Q2 (GAB, GAG) 2016 – 2026 1.0 TFSI (CHZJ) – 85 kW / 115 HP
AUDI Q2 (GAB, GAG) 2016 – 2026 1.4 TFSI (CZEA) – 110 kW / 150 HP
AUDI Q2 (GAB, GAG) 2016 – 2026 2.0 TDI (CRFC) – 105 kW / 143 HP
